    I too have been on a very sensible diet and workout plan this past month and some change. Im not having as much problem with food as i did in the beginning and of course exercise is an everyday hurtle, but I have never been so happy and appreciative of life and all the wonderful things it has to offer. The only thing is i think about 4 months from now and it makes the future seem far and impossible. I am 21 I started out at 237 end of Dec and now at 221 as of yesterday. Im not really sure if im dieting exactly the way im supposed to i eat at least three decent size meals a day and workout at least 5 to 6 times a week. I guess i just need reassurance from you ladies. I just feels so far away and impossible and then on top of that what if im doing this all wrong?!?

    Welcome to WH.
    It certainly sounds like you are on the right track. Have you cut out fried foods, refined flour products, sugary sweets, soda (including diet)? Eating lots of fresh veggies and fruits, lean meats, whole grains?

    You didn't get where you are overnight and it will take time to get to a healthier you. You can do it. We have several ladies here who have. Just stick to it. Focus on health rather than weight and you'll keep seeing results.
